Benefits of Ginger (Adrak)
Ginger is rich in natural compounds like gingerol, which help fight inflammation and infections.
Diseases and conditions it may help reduce:
- 🤢 Digestive problems (gas, bloating, indigestion)
- 🤒 Cold and flu symptoms
- 🧠 Inflammation-related pain (joint pain, muscle pain)
- ❤️ Heart-related risks (by improving blood circulation)
- 🤰 Nausea and vomiting (especially morning sickness)
Ginger is also known to improve metabolism and support immunity.
Benefits of Garlic (Lehsan)
Garlic contains a powerful compound called allicin, which has strong antibacterial and antiviral effects.
Diseases and conditions it may help reduce:
- ❤️ High blood pressure (hypertension)
- 🫀 High cholesterol levels
- 🦠 Infections (bacterial and viral)
- 🧬 Weak immune system
- 🧠 Risk of heart disease and stroke
Garlic is especially good for heart health and immunity.

Important Notes
- Do not consume in very large amounts daily
- People on blood-thinning medicines should consult a doctor
- Excess garlic may cause stomach irritation in some people
